Processors Hypercube
This is specific to in the hypercube: Here, every processor is depicted by the set of nodes of the graph and the several arcs are represented with communication links. The nodes status can be busy, idle, sending, receiving etc. and are showed with the help of a specific color. An arc is drawn among two processors when message is sent from one node to another and is deleted when the message is received.
Utilisation Displays
It shows the information about distribution of work among the processors and the effectiveness of the processors.
